About this property

Ontario Glamping Cabin, Perfect for Discovering Port Dover

Escape to this beautiful forest cabin nestled on 40 private acres, surrounded by nature and abundant wildlife—including deer, wild turkeys, and songbirds. Located just 15 minutes from the sandy shores of Turkey Point and Port Dover, this secluded getaway offers the perfect blend of rustic charm and convenience.

The space

Here’s what you’ll enjoy during your stay:

• A peaceful bunkie tucked in 40 forested acres

• Queen bed in a cozy loft (accessible by ladder), a fouton and a king

• Fire pit with wood, 2 grills, and a shaded gazebo

• Simple kitchen setup with 2 person dining table, cooler, utensils, and BBQ

• Shower with warm water, shared toilet & outdoor well water tap

• Picnic table for outdoor dining

• Dog-friendly space with lots of room to roam

• Trails for exploring, star-gazing, and reconnecting



Come to The Pinecone Bunkie to truly unplug and unwind. With a king-size bed on the main level and a cozy loft queen bed above and a pull out couch for extra guests, this space offers the ideal setting to relax and recharge. You'll find both a main floor sleeping area and an inviting loft for added comfort. The loft bed is cozy and comfortable, and you'll wake to soft morning light through the trees. There’s a small indoor table for two and solar lighting for nighttime ambiance. Prep food at the picnic table, grill over the fire, or just kick back with a book and listen to the birds.



Everything you need is here—just bring your blankets, your food, and your sense of adventure.

Water & Electricity There is no drinking water on-site—please bring your own. Electricity is available in the bunkie (solar-powered).



Wi-Fi & Cell Service: There is no Wi-Fi and very limited or no cell service. Plan to unplug and enjoy the quiet.



Garbage: There are no large garbage bins and no road side pickup. Please be prepared to bring your garbage to the dump during your stay, or you need to bring it home with you to dispose of. If any garbage is left behind a $75 cleanup, transfer and dump fee will be charged.



Temperature & Seasons: The bunkie is available year-round, however, it is not insulated. If you are coming in winter or intermit weather, we are assuming you "know what you're in for" and will pack and dress appropriately to be in the bush. In winter, the road may not be plowed and could require a short walk in. Bring extra blankets for chilly nights.
